Add ENST (Enhanced Network Scheduling and Timing) register definitions
to support IEEE 802.1Qbv time-gated transmission.
Register architecture:
- Per-queue timing registers: ENST_START_TIME, ENST_ON_TIME, ENST_OFF_TIME
- Centralized control of the ENST_CONTROL register for enabling or
disabling queue gates.
- Time intervals programmed in hardware byte units
- Hardware-level queue scheduling infrastructure.
